Do you love animating data, creating science apps, illustrating engineering concepts, or taking photographs of the natural world? In the Vizzies, sponsored by the National Science Foundation and Popular Science, your handiwork can receive its due glory and win cash prizes. Submission deadline is April 15, 2018.

In partnership with PopSci.com, the National Science Foundation's (NSF) Vizzies Challenge, now in its 16th year, invites researchers and members of the general public to submit their best science or engineering visualization.

NSF and PopSci.com will feature the winning entries on their respective websites. In addition, up to 5 Experts' Choice winning entries will receive $2,000 each, and up to 3 People's Choice winning entries will receive $500 each. You can learn more about the competition and view previous year's winners at the NSF Vizzies Challenge website.

In the past, NSF has featured winning visualizations on many NSF products, including brochures, banners, and social media, and coverage of the winners has been extensive, with articles appearing in The Washington Post.

DEADLINE
April 15, 2018

SUBMISSION
Entries may be submitted by individuals or by teams through the NSF Vizzies Challenge website.
